Analyst applicants have rated the interview process at Spotify with 2.7 out of 5 (where 5 is the highest level of difficulty) and assessed their interview experience as 36% positive. To compare, the company-average is 47.4% positive. This is according to Glassdoor user ratings.
Candidates applying for Analyst roles take an average of 35 days to get hired, when considering 12 user submitted interviews for this role. To compare, the hiring process at Spotify overall takes an average of 39 days.
Common stages of the interview process at Spotify as a Analyst according to 12 Glassdoor interviews include:
Phone interview: 38%
One on one interview: 19%
Presentation: 12%
Skills test: 8%
Group panel interview: 8%
IQ intelligence test: 8%
Personality test: 4%
Drug test: 4%

4 rounds process, incl. take-home case. Interviews were relatively straightforward with HR, Hiring manager, and Directors in the team. Mix of behavioral and technical questions. Take-home case was quite time consuming but very relevant for the role (recieve data set with a case question - expected to build a financial model and short presentation deck)
